Marie gets some food.

Marie gets some food. is an oil painting by the Post-Impressionist artist Joakim Skovgaard. It dates from 1906 and is held in the collection of the Statens Museum for Kunst. 'Marie gets some food' is a 1906 oil painting by Danish artist Joakim Frederik Skovgaard, known for his work in fresco.

Subject & Meaning
The painting depicts a tender scene: a woman in a striped dress feeds a young girl in white, set against a dark green wall adorned with framed pictures.
Technique & Style
Thick, visible brushstrokes characterize the work, lending texture and vibrancy to the colors, particularly in the woman's dress and the girl's skin.
History & Provenance
Created in 1906, 'Marie gets some food' is associated with the post-impressionist movement and is part of the Statens Museum for Kunst collection.

Artist
Joakim Frederik Skovgaard (18 November 1856 – 9 March 1933) was a Danish painter. He is remembered above all for the frescos which decorate Viborg Cathedral.
